Free release

874954-29-7 2,4-imidazolidinedione,3-[4-methoxy-3-[2-(3-pyrrolidinylamino)ethoxy]phenyl]-5,5-dimethy

service@apichina.com
Product Name 2,4-Imidazolidinedione,3-[4-methoxy-3-[2-(3-pyrrolidinylamino)ethoxy]phenyl]-5,5-dimethyl-1-(4-quinolinylmethyl)-, monohydrochloride
CAS No. 874954-29-7
Molecular Formula C28H33N5O4・ClH